摘要
This paper uses Reliability-centered Maintenance (RCM) method to optimize the maintenance strategy of circulating water pump in Daya Bay nuclear power plant. The overhaul cycle of circulating water pump is given in the paper, and the cycle is far more than the proposed cycle (8 years) of vendor and the cycle of similar equipment at home and abroad, not only greatly reducing the maintenance costs, but also decreasing maintenance-induced failures, thus further improving the equipment reliability and availability. ©, 2015, Editorial Office of Nuclear Power Engineering.
